Description
We are building a new, foundational automation system which will transform warehouse operations by combining multiple novel workcells. We are seeking experienced Senior Software (firmware) Development Engineer to spearhead optimizing, deploying, and enhancing a fleet of robotics systems. Ideal candidate will be experienced in robotic path planning, motion control and computer vision. They are passionate about software development, architecture and has a track record of designing and implementing new products and features. They are a hands-on expert, with a deep and broad understanding of software tools and complex algorithm development.As a part of applied automation & controls team, they will build advanced control systems for manipulation robots. The stack includes custom hardware, embedded Linux, Computer Vision, Motor Control, Safety, IO Protocols for attached devices and more.
Key job responsibilities
This brand new system is a critical priority for the Robotics organization. As a key member, you will:
- Design and implement highly reliable embedded control systems
- Develop and optimize real-time control algorithms. Validate designs through simulation and real-world testing
- Drive system architecture choices that impact the future of Amazon’s warehouse robotics systems
- Enhance Observability Tools: Create and improve monitoring and observability tools for tracking, debugging, and learning across global deployments.
- Mentor junior engineers and provide technical leadership to the team, fostering a culture of excellence and continuous improvement.
- Integration and Validation: Integrate, test, and validate new features on live systems, ensuring they meet stringent performance and reliability standards.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work with experts across disciplines—including perception, hardware, and software—to create intelligent, integrated systems and solutions.
- 15-20% travel expected to support onsite system testing

Qualifications
- 5+ years of non-internship professional software development experience- 5+ years of programming with at least one software programming language experience
- 5+ years of leading design or architecture (design patterns, reliability and scaling) of new and existing systems experience
- Experience as a mentor, tech lead or leading an engineering team
- Expert level skills with C/C++
- Experience building complex embedded systems
Extended Qualifications
- 5+ years of full software development life cycle, including coding standards, code reviews, source control management, build processes, testing, and operations experience- Bachelor's degree in computer science or equivalent
- Experience with real time motion control software.
- Understanding of control systems theory
- Experience with troubleshooting/debugging of hardware
- Familiarity with common bus protocols such as Modbus, CAN bus, Ethernet/IP, EtherCAT, etc.
- Experience as a team lead / team advisor with ownership of technical deliverables.
